Plasma: Why a Stablecoin-First Blockchain Actually Makes Sense

Most blockchains today try to do everything at once DeFi, NFTs, gaming, AI, memes, you name it. Plasma took a very different approach and honestly, that’s exactly why its worth paying attention to.Plasma is a Layer-1 blockchain built specifically for stablecoin payments. Not as a side feature. Not as a marketing hook. Stablecoins are the core of the entire design And in a market where USDT and other stablecoins already move billions of dollars every day, that focus feels both obvious and overdue.

If you have ever sent USDT on Ethereum during congestion or paid surprising fees on other networks, you already understand the problem Plasma is trying to solve. Payments should be fast, cheap and predictable especially when real money is involved. That’s where plasma stands out.
Built for Real Usage, Not Just SpeculationPlasma biggest headline feature is zero-fee USDT transfers. Instead of forcing users to hold native tokens just to send stablecoins, the network uses a paymaster system that covers gas for basic transfers. That may sound small but for onboarding everyday users, businesses, and remittance flows, it’s a game changer.

On the performance side, Plasma isn’t messing around. With sub-second block times and high throughput, the chain is optimized for high-volume payments not just occasional on-chain interactions. This is infrastructure designed for usage at scale, not just DeFi power users.
Another smart move: full EVM compatibility. Developers dont need to learn new languages or tooling. If you have built on Ethereum before, Plasma feels familiar. Solidity contracts, existing wallets and common dev tools all work out of the box. That lowers friction for builders and speeds up ecosystem growth.
Anchored to Bitcoin, Connected to EthereumOne of Plasma most interesting design choices is its Bitcoin-anchored security model. Through a trust-minimized bridge, Bitcoin liquidity can enter Plasma’s ecosystem in a usable form, while still benefiting from Bitcoin’s security assumptions.

This gives Plasma a unique position:
Bitcoin for security and liquidity
Ethereum tooling for smart contracts
A custom Layer-1 optimized for stablecoins
That combination isn’t common — and it’s powerful.
The Role of $XPL in the NetworkThe XPL token isn’t just there for speculation. It playing a real role in keeping the network organization :

Validators stake XPL to secure the chain
XPL is used for gas, performance and protocol operations.
Commission allows holders to participate in network awards without running infrastructure
Rather than pushing hype-driven narratives, Plasma token model is focused on long-term sustainability and aligned incentives.At launch, Plasma attracted billions of dollars in stablecoin liquidity and integrations with major DeFi protocols a strong signal that builders and users see real value here, not just a short-term trend.
Why Plasma Matters Going Forward
Stablecoins are already one of crypto’s most successful use cases. Payments, remittances, savings, and on-chain dollars are growing faster than most other sectors yet the infrastructure behind them is still fragmented and inefficient.Plasma is betting on a simple idea: if you optimize the base layer for stablecoins, everything else becomes easier.
If adoption continues and real transaction volume keeps growing, Plasma could quietly become one of the most important settlement layers in crypto not flashy, but essential.

Plasma Is Quietly Redefining How Stablecoins Move at Scale

If you have spent enough time in crypto, you have probably noticed a gap between promise and reality when it comes to payments. Stablecoins were supposed to make global money movement instant and cheap yet sending USDT can still be slow, costly, or frustrating depending on the chain.
That's why plasma has been catching my attention lately.Plasma isnt trying to be everything for everyone. Instead, it’s doing something refreshingly focused : building a blockchain specifically optimized for stablecoin payments. And that focus makes all the difference.
A Chain Designed for How Stablecoins Are Actually Used. Most blockchains weren’t designed with stablecoins in mind. Plasma is From the ground up, the network prioritizes fast settlement, predictable costs and real usability especially for USDT transfers. With Plasma, users can send USDT with zero transfer fees, thanks to its built-in paymaster system. That alone removes one of the biggest friction points in everyday crypto payments.On top of that, Plasma delivers sub second finality and high throughput, making it suitable not just for individuals but also for businesses, remittance services, and payment platforms that need consistency at scale.Importantly, Plasma remains EVM compatible, which means developers dont need to relearn everything to build here. Existing Ethereum tooling, contracts, and experience carry over smoothly.
Why XPL Matters in the Ecosystem.At the center of Plasma’s economy is not as a speculative add on but as a functional backbone.XPL plays a role in validator staking, network security and powering smart contract execution beyond simple transfers. As activity on the network grows, demand for XPL becomes increasingly tied to real usage rather than hype.With a capped supply and long term token distribution focused on ecosystem growth, Plasma appears to be aligning incentives between users, builders and validators from the start something many projects only think about later.
Strong Early Signals from Mainnet Activity
Since launching its mainnet, Plasma has demonstrated early momentum that’s hard to ignore. The network went live with significant stablecoin liquidity and immediate DeFi integrations, signaling serious preparation behind the scenes.Rather than chasing short term narratives, Plasma seems to be positioning itself where real on chain volume already exists : stablecoin transfers, settlement and payment flows. That’s where long term value is likely to be built. Looking Forward What stands out most about Plasma is restraint. There’s no attempt to overpromise or dominate headlines. The focus remains clear : make stablecoins work better, faster and cheaper at global scale.If stablecoins truly are the bridge between traditional finance and crypto, then the infrastructure behind them matters more than ever. Plasma feels like a step toward that future practical, purposebbuilt, and quietly ambitious.For anyone watching the evolution of payments in Web3,@Plasma and XPL are worth paying attention to.
